Embrace Innovative Tools

Ever heard the saying, "A craftsman is only as good as his tools"? This rings especially true in the kitchen. Investing in high-quality kitchen gadgets can streamline your cooking process and elevate your dishes to new heights. Consider tools like a versatile multi-cooker, a precision kitchen scale, or a set of razor-sharp knives. These investments pay off by saving time and improving the consistency and quality of your food.

Explore New Flavors

Transforming your culinary realm is also about daring to step out of your comfort zone with flavors and ingredients. Experiment with exotic spices, unusual produce, and alternative grains to discover new taste profiles that can add excitement to your meals. Enhancing your palate can be as simple as visiting a local farmers' market or an ethnic grocery store to inspire your next culinary creation.

Optimize Your Space

A well-organized kitchen is a happy kitchen. Start by decluttering your counters and cabinets. Invest in storage solutions that make sense for your space and cooking habits. A tidy kitchen not only looks better, but it also makes cooking more efficient and enjoyable. Consider the ergonomics of your workspace—everything should have a place, and the flow should facilitate ease of movement during meal prep.
